Nhtml meta content type pdf files

If youre trying to play html5 video with the tag, ensure the correct content type header is being sent for your source media. Two such meta elements that are useful to include on your page define the author of the page, and provide a concise description of the page. To save the metadata as a template, choose save metadata template from the dialog box menu in the upper right corner, and name the file. These resources are usually represented as external links. If one of the two files was returned without a contenttype metadata. In creating a pdf file, acrobat essentially takes a snapshot of an electronic file. Properly configuring server mime types web security mdn. Here is a list of mime types, associated by type of documents, ordered by their common extensions. Ophelie was head of content at sitepoint and sitepoint premium.

If you click the save button, your code will be saved, and you get an url you can share with others. It has become recommended to always use the meta content type tag even if you use a dtd declaration above the header. The content property sets or returns the value of the content attribute of a meta element. Contenttypeapplicationpdf doesnt seem to tell the browser that this actually is a pdffile. If you are browsing this page with a phone or a tablet, you can click on the two links below to see the difference. Unlike html files, mht files are not restricted to holding just text content. Unfortunately pdf files get served with contenttypetextplain e. But, there are a few things you need to remember when declaring your web files characterset as utf8. The name attribute specifies a name for the informationvalue of the content attribute. See how to force files to open in browser instead of download pdf. If the equiv attribute is set, the name attribute should not be set. A mime type is a string identifier composed of two parts.

Browsers will do mime sniffing in some cases and will not necessarily follow the value of this header. Here is an example of a web page without the viewport meta tag, and the same web page with the viewport meta tag. After that i add html content that intiates request to a. Sendgrid apex attachment functionality is not working. To edit pdf metadata online with the help of pdf candy, start with uploading of the file for posterior processing. Two primary mime types are important for the role of default types. In the next article well be looking at html text fundamentals. When used as the value of the rel attribute to a link from document a to document b, or in the rev attribute of a link from b to a, this indicates that document a is a generic document and b a more specific document, in that a may exist in multiple contenttypes, but b is is available in a particular contenttype.

Creating templates like a professional html and css this section only shows what you can do to improve the layout of an html document in general. If one of the two files was returned without a contenttype metadata, or with a. Incorrect contenttype for pdf files showing 112 of 12 messages. To indicate to the browser that the file should be viewed in the browser. If you store the pdf and inspect the stored pdf, is that stored pdffile working correctly. Doctype, metadata and meta tags bradenton website design. In responses, a contenttype header tells the client what the content type of the returned content actually is. Creating templates like a professional html and css. Dim binarydata as byte binarydata getdatahere response. Mhtml, short for mime html, is a web page archive format used to combine resources that are typically represented by external links such as images, flash animations, java applets, audio. These information are not to show to the browser, but only for the machine use like the search engine and the web browser. The assignment is defined in rfc 3778, the applicationpdf media type, referenced from the mime media types registry mime types are controlled by a standards body, the internet assigned numbers authority iana. Why do we need the meta content type tag in html head.

Browsers dont open our pdf, but open all other pdfs closed ask question asked 4 years, 9 months ago. Html type name and list of matches will appear 2 double click empty field and list of all possible matches will appear 3 single click empty field to make the list disappear again. Although nowadays we have email, sms services integrated in most of web applications, sometimes there could be need of documentation for future reference which users may want to reuse later based on their need. In addition, this clever and smallsize application can help you edit targeting properties professionally. To use the saved metadata in another pdf, open the document and use these instructions to replace or append metadata in the document. A textual file should be humanreadable and must not contain binary data. Save your files in utf8 encoding without the byteorder mark bom. By default, many web servers are configured to report a mime type of.

The text contenttype is intended for sending material which is principally textual in form. The contenttype entity header is used to indicate the media type of the resource in responses, a contenttype header tells the client what the content type of the returned content actually is. Proper mime media type for pdf files stack overflow. Would it help if you create the pdf file, save it on server and just send the download link to client. The goal is to set a charset in the url as parameter and use that value in the header as charset. Add the new metadata values, press the apply changes button and download. You should read this if you want to change an html template manually.

So how can we easily create pdf files from other formats like word, txt, epub and other formats files. This is the same organization that manages the root name servers and the ip address space. You can choose to view just one type of media file in elements organizer. Add file button will let you upload the file from your device. The contenttype entity header is used to indicate the media type of the resource. The meta elements can be used to include namevalue pairs describing properties of the html document, such as author, expiry date, a list of keywords, document author etc. As the web gets older this function does not have the same importance. Are you sure you implement the mail sending correctly. Solved download dynamic pdf from web method codeproject.

The content attribute specifies the content of the meta information. Pdf to mht converter convert pdf files to editable mht. Mime headers in html pages html forum at webmasterworld. If you want to allow the user to scale the page remove userscalableno and maximumscale1. Well organized and easy to understand web building tutorials with lots of examples of how to use html, css, javascript, sql, php, python, bootstrap, java and xml. When you select a media type, you can perform other searches that look only for the type of media you want. Dec 02, 2015 im trying to set up an application that sets the contenttype response header dynamically. Ive done some research on contentdisposition and contenttype in a html file s header to force downloading files like pdfs instead of automatically displaying them in the browser but im a but confused as to how i should have them placed in my html file. But if the user wants to download file and the real filename is file. The assignment is defined in rfc 3778, the application pdf media type, referenced from the mime media types registry. I notice that you separated your words with both a comma and a space. A media type also known as a multipurpose internet mail extensions or mime type is a standard that indicates the nature and format of a document, file, or assortment of bytes. In earlier times some mata tags provided the information to search engines crawlers.

Its an application to test a 3rd party integration in various charset encoding environments. The meta content type tag is used to declare the character set of a website. Declare the encoding in your html files using meta charset like above. Setting doctype and meta tags by professor floyd jay winters. Maybe a lot easier to use a library for sending email. Example following is an example of redirecting current page to another page after 5 seconds.

The use of xpdf predates the standardization of the mime type for pdf. Aug 18, 2011 i am trying to display a pdf file which i am being passed from a web service as a binary stream in a browser, but i am being prompted to save the file instead. In responses, a content type header tells the client what the content type of the returned content actually is. The mht converter tool has the capability to convert and save mht to pdf file,also mhtml to pdf making it easy for user to save them securely in any system for future reference or print the converted files, if required. Convert mht to pdf page layout files online and without. Mime types are controlled by a standards body, the internet assigned numbers authority iana. The content of resulting files is encoded in the same way as in html email messages. I have a question that i hope someone can help me with. The available values of this property depends on the value of the name and the equiv properties. I am using send grid apex package for sending out bulk email from salesforce. If this is the case, why include the meta tag at all. We spend countless hours researching various file formats and software that can open, convert, create or otherwise work with those files.

Published on 29 march 2018 in rails generating pdf files from html content. The html 5 specification specifies an algorithm for determining content types based on widely deployed practices and software. The name attribute specifies the name for the metadata. If you want to search by media type along with one or more other search criteria, use the find by details metadata command. Finding media files by content, type, and metadata in. What the hell is may 03, 2009 this meta contents are used to provide information about the website. Oct 10, 2011 i will show you my way to convert pdf to mhtml.

While we do not yet have a description of the mhtml file format and what it is normally used for, we do know which programs are known to open these files. But it failed for every other type of files like pdf etc. Mht mhtml is intended for archiving web pages and combining the html code and resources images, animation, audio files, into a single html file. Verypdf pdf to mht converter is a standalone converter for windows platforms, which is used to batch convert acrobat pdf files to mht files, including mht 2010, 2007, 2003, 2000, etc. Is there any other way to convert mhtml file to adobe pdf format. Some browsers, such as chrome, seem willing to play a video regardless of its content type perhaps through sniffing or file extensions, but others, such as ie, require a valid and supported value.

Implementing a complete mailing script, including correct encoded attachment and more working for the most mail programs, is not simple. Mybe there is only a mistyping, but i shuld like a complete list of the options for contenttype, like what phrase to use for all kind of files. From the servlet, i am setting the content type for the response as res. Html lets you specify metadata additional important information about a document in a variety of ways. My firefox and chrome usually open pdf files very nicely, without asking and within the browser window. Sep 27, 2015 participate in discussions with other treehouse members and learn. Use just one or the other no need to waste file size. As an example, an html file might be designated texthtml. Of course, this is just a workaround, and things related to mapping between mime types and filename extensions file types when available on the client os should be done by. A charset parameter may be used to indicate the character set of the body text. Its possible to send text files as a attachment with the help of send grid api.

That marks the end of our quickfire tour of the html head theres a lot more you can do in here, but an exhaustive tour would be boring and confusing at this stage, and we just wanted to give you an idea of the most common things youll find in there for now. Mhtml, short for mime html, is a web page archive format used to combine resources that are typically represented by external links such as images, flash animations, java applets, audio files together with html code into a single file. Mht file extension is an mhtml web archive file that can hold html files, images, animation, audio, and other media content. You can use the mac pdf creator to easily change text, word docx, mobi and all kinds of images to high quality pdf file on mac. If you fail to do so, it may cause display problems. Browse other questions tagged pdf headers contenttype mime or ask your own question. If you want to redirect page immediately then do not specify content attribute.

92 1064 676 580 118 794 720 1364 447 993 1058 1184 403 229 813 1352 950 388 1100 409 273 539 75 889 851 622 1482 296 437 1345 1352 1095 1451 730 625 238 636 667 772